vsphere ha故障切换资源不足 (解决方法与步骤)
下面内容仅为某些场景参考,为稳妥起见请先联系上面的专业技术工程师,具体环境具体分析。
2023-09-18 20:10 121
名词定义和产生的案例举例
VSphere HA(High Availability)是一种VMware vSphere提供的高可用性解决方案。它通过监控虚拟机和物理主机状态,并在主机出现故障时自动重新启动虚拟机,以确保应用程序的连续可用性。一个案例是,在一个vSphere集群中,一台物理主机发生故障,导致其中的虚拟机无法正常运行。这时,VSphere HA会检测到主机故障,并将故障主机上的虚拟机重新分配到其他健康的主机上,实现自动故障切换和资源再平衡。
产生原因及造成后果
可能产生资源不足的原因包括: - 物理主机故障导致资源丢失; - 虚拟机资源配置不合理,导致某些虚拟机占用过多资源; - 虚拟机数量过多,导致整体资源不足。资源不足可能造成以下后果: - 虚拟机运行缓慢甚至无法启动,影响应用程序的正常运行; - 虚拟机服务中断,影响业务连续性; - 数据丢失或损坏,导致无法恢复或数据完整性受损。
解决方案
为了解决资源不足问题,可以采取以下措施: - 增加物理主机数量:增加可用资源的总量,提高整体资源利用率; - 调整虚拟机资源配置:根据实际需求,合理分配CPU、内存和存储资源,避免资源浪费; - 使用分布式资源调度(DRS):通过在集群中自动迁移虚拟机,实现资源均衡,提高整体性能; - 使用vSphere HA主机资源保留:通过配置主机资源保留,保证故障切换后的资源足够; - 升级硬件:使用更高配置的硬件设备,提供更大的资源容量。注意事项
- 在进行硬件升级或调整资源配置之前,需提前计划,并进行充分的,以避免影响到现有的虚拟机和业务运行; - 在迁移虚拟机之前,需要对虚拟机的亲和性和反亲和性进行规划和配置,以确保虚拟机迁移后能够正常运行; - 需要定期监控和调整虚拟机和物理主机的资源使用情况,及时发现并解决资源不足的问题。相关FAQ
1. Q: VSphere HA如何检测物理主机故障? A: VSphere HA通过心跳机制检测主机故障,它会检测主机上的ESXi服务是否正常运行。2. Q: 是否可以手动触发VSphere HA进行故障切换? A: 是的,可以手动触发VSphere HA进行故障切换,但需要确保集群中存在足够的健康主机来承担故障主机上的虚拟机。
3. Q: 如何避免资源不足导致的故障切换? A: 可以通过正确配置和规划资源来避免资源不足问题,同时也要定期监控和调整资源使用情况。
4. Q: DRS和VSphere HA有何区别? A: DRS是用于资源调度和负载均衡的功能,而VSphere HA是用于故障切换和提高应用程序的可用性的功能。
5. Q: VSphere HA是否支持跨多个数据中心的故障切换? A: 是的,VSphere HA可以支持跨多个数据中心进行故障切换,前提是数据中心之间已经配置了适当的网络和存储连接。